 Building Principal Position Summary Willow Creek Middle School is seeking a dynamic and student-centered Social Studies teacher. The ideal candidate creates engaging, inquiry-driven learning experiences, fosters strong relationships with students, and collaborates effectively with interdisciplinary teams. This teacher will help students develop historical thinking skills, civic understanding, geographic literacy, and the ability to analyze multiple perspectives. Key Responsibilities Plan and deliver engaging, standards-aligned instruction in 6th and 7th grade social studies courses Use a variety of instructional strategies that promote critical thinking, discussion, and student inquiry Design lessons that integrate literacy, primary sources, and evidence-based reasoning Differentiate instruction to meet the needs of diverse learners Use formative and summative assessment data to guide instructional decisions Create a positive, structured classroom culture that supports student engagement and belonging Collaborate with grade-level and interdisciplinary teams on curriculum, assessments, and student support Communicate effectively with students, families, and staff Incorporate instructional technology to enhance learning Participate in professional learning and ongoing school improvement efforts Support the school's mission, values, and student-centered approach Qualifications Valid Indiana Teaching License in Social Studies (or appropriate content area) for middle school grades, or eligibility for licensure Any questions should be directed to Jane Bitting, Principal, jane.bitting@nacs.k12.in.us
